ROLE SUMMARY The Systems Design Reliability Engineering (SDRE) team is building the next generation of AI-assisted, model-driven systems engineering at Rivian VW Group — replacing heavyweight requirements processes with simulation-first design, Digital Twin-based verification and test coverage. We are a small, high-leverage team, and we are looking for an engineer who wants to work at the intersection of AI tooling and physical system modelling. You will develop and operate the AI tooling and Digital Twin infrastructure that underpins SDRE's cross-domain methods — across Vehicle Controls, Infotainment, Communications, and Access. You will own feature(s) end-to-end: from building plant models and co-simulation environments, to deploying LLM-assisted requirement and test pipelines. You will also do real systems engineering — author requirements, perform analyses, design reviews, STPA, and apply SDRE methods hands-on. RESPONSIBILITIES 1. Digital Twin Development & Operation - Build and maintain multi-fidelity plant models (FMU-packaged) for vehicle subsystems — powertrain, dynamics, thermal, body — using Python, OpenModelica, Julia, or Simulink. - Develop and run co-simulation environments (FMI-based) that pair vECUs with plant models for three core use cases: - Model-to-code — simulate vehicle behaviors against a plant to develop and validate control requirements before a line of production code is written. - SIL regression tests — run SIL/virtual ECU controllers against plant models in nightly CI to catch regressions early and expand corner-case coverage. - Field issue replay — reproduce field failures in the digital twin, verify fixes virtually before shipping. - Correlate models against real vehicle, dyno, and lab rig and fleet data 2. AI-Assisted Systems Engineering Tooling - Build LLM pipelines for requirement drafting, test script generation, coverage gap analysis, and root cause analysis over SE artifacts. - Deploy semantic search and RAG over requirements, architecture models, test scripts, using modern LLM app stacks (LangChain, LlamaIndex, or equivalent). - Integrate AI assistants into GitLab and test management systems via APIs, plugins, and CI/CD pipelines. - Build AI analytics tools that correlate requirements, architecture changes, and calibrations with fleet data, field issues and test failures — surfacing similar historical problems and candidate fault paths. 3. Systems Engineering (Hands-On) - Author requirements and test cases as a practicing systems engineer — applying RequiTest and test-driven SE methods. - Participate in architecture, interface, and safety design reviews across domains. - Document AI-augmented SE process standards and playbooks; help drive adoption across programmes. - Capture process patterns from domain teams and convert them into AI-supported workflows, with human-in-the-loop guardrails.
